At its core, the artistic style of "Duke’s Hardcore Honeys" is deeply indebted to the aesthetic of the 1990s "bad girl" comic era. During this time, mainstream comics saw a surge in female characters defined by impossibly proportioned physiques, scantily clad costumes, and hyper-violent personas (e.g., Vampirella, Lady Death, and early iterations of Spawn’s female antagonists). Duke adopts this visual language wholesale but removes the euphemistic "peek-a-boo" censorship typical of mainstream publishers. The result is an art style that is unapologetically maximalist. The lines are thick, the colors are often saturated, and the anatomy is pushed to the point of surrealism. This exaggeration is not an accident of poor draftsmanship; rather, it is a deliberate stylistic choice meant to elevate the characters from mere humans to idealized, almost cartoonish avatars of sexual fantasy.

Furthermore, "Duke’s Hardcore Honeys" serves as a fascinating case study in the modern economics of independent adult art. Historically, adult comics were distributed through the underground comix movement of the 1960s and 70s, championed by creators like Robert Crumb, who used the medium to subvert societal norms regarding sex and censorship. Today, the internet has democratized the creation and distribution of adult content. Duke’s work thrives in this digital ecosystem, utilizing subscription-based models, direct digital sales, and dedicated adult forums. By operating outside the traditional Comics Code Authority (which is now defunct but whose shadow still looms over mainstream distribution) and the Big Two publishers (Marvel and DC), Duke retains total creative control. This allows for an unfiltered expression of his specific aesthetic, though it also confines the work to a specialized, niche audience. dukes hardcore honeys comics
